Buying a tea plant allows you to grow and process your own "true" teas—including green, black, oolong, and white—directly from your garden or home. This evergreen shrub is not only functional but also ornamental, producing fragrant white flowers in the fall and winter. Choosing the Right Variety Tea plant - Camellia sinensis - Kew Gardens
